Fine Behaviors of Eigenvalues and Eigenfunctions of the Lane-Emden Problem in Dimension Two

Recently, qualitative analysis of peaked solutions of Lane-Emden problem in dimension two has been widely considered. In particular, the Morse index of concentrated solutions with a single peak or multi peaks has been computed in [15,16] separately. In this paper, we continue to consider the qualitative properties of the eigenvalues and eigenfunctions of the linearized Lane-Emden problem associated to peak solutions. Here we establish the fine behaviors of the first $m$ eigenvalues and eigenfunctions of the linearized Lane-Emden problem in dimension two, and correspondingly the number of concentrated points of the first $m$ eigenfunctions are given.
